Zechariah

ESV

Chapter 13

1“On that day there shall be a fountain opened for the house of David and the inhabitants of Jerusalem, to cleanse them from sin and uncleanness. 2“And on that day, declares the LORD of hosts, I will cut off the names of the idols from the land, so that they shall be remembered no more. And I will also remove from the land the prophets and the spirit of uncleanness. 3And if anyone again prophesies, then his father and mother who bore him will say to him, ‘You shall not live, for you speak lies in the name of the LORD.’ And his father and mother who bore him will pierce him through when he prophesies. 4“On that day every prophet will be ashamed of his vision when he prophesies. He will not put on a hairy cloak in order to deceive, 5but he will say, ‘I am no prophet, I am a worker of the soil, for I have been a herdsman from my youth.’ 6And if one asks him, ‘What are these wounds on your body?’ he will answer, ‘The wounds I received in the house of my friends.’ 7“Awake, O sword, against my shepherd, against the man who is my fellow,” declares the LORD of hosts. “Strike the shepherd, and the sheep will be scattered; I will turn my hand against the little ones. 8In the whole land, declares the LORD, two thirds shall be cut off and perish, and one third shall be left alive. 9And I will put this third into the fire, and refine them as silver is refined, and test them as gold is tested. They will call upon my name, and I will answer them. I will say, ‘They are my people’; and they will say, ‘The LORD is my God.’”
